Moral: If you have not recieved your item from Dali after 40 days. No matter what, open a claim with PayPal as after 45 days you are screwed!

---
My story is just like any of the other hundreds of MJ ripoff stories over the years. But as an NSX owner and a member of this forum I feel compelled to post it. Perhaps the sheer volume of negative comments can dissude people from buying from Dali.

I know people are going to reply about how he shipped it within 3 hours of placing the order and how wonderful he is to them. Just wait tho, it'll happen to you too. It seems like getting ripped off from Dali is just like "death and taxes" - you might be able to avoid them for a while, but you can never escape them.

I opened a PayPal claim today, but being the trusting idiot I was I had waited too long. I am way out of the 45 day window it's now been 4 months and now I am SOL and will probably never see my $211.

On April 9th I sent payment promptly after ordering the items (Harness Bar camera mount and custom seat cushion) and was told via email by Mark Johnson that the items were in stock and he would ship next day - although he stated he may PP request me for some additional shipping charges he did not. I waited 9 days and after not receiving the items I send the following mail - to which Mark Johnson replied.

This was the last recorded contact I had with Mark Johnson although I sent him no less than 6 friendly emails attempting to contact him. I refrained from involving PayPal immediately as I know he is probably busy. Since he has not replied to any of my emails and not shipped a product that I paid for over 4 months ago - I am entitled to a full refund. I have full email records (which I know doesn't stand up in court) - but if you check your vendor file on Mark Johnson I'm sure you'll see similar complaints.
